Skagen Odde Nature Centre Skagen Odde Nature Centre is inspired by the fascination of Skagen’ s distinctive natural environment. The meeting of the two seas at Grenen. The migrating dune – Råbjerg Mile. The special strong light in Skagen. What actually takes place? And why here? Visiting the centre you will be able to see, hear and feel the relationship between man and nature in this unique building, designed by the world famous architect, Jorn Utzon, who also designed the Sydney Opera House.
